Choosing the Right Silane Coupling Agent: A Guide for Formulators
For formulators in the coatings, adhesives, and composites industries, selecting the right silane coupling agent is paramount to achieving desired material properties. These specialized chemicals act as molecular bridges, significantly improving the bond between inorganic substrates and organic polymers. This results in enhanced mechanical strength, better moisture resistance, and increased durability of the final product. One such compound gaining attention for its efficacy is Bis(diethylamino)dimethylsilane (CAS 4669-59-4). This versatile organosilicon chemical, available from reputable suppliers, serves as an excellent silane coupling agent. Its unique structure allows it to react with both inorganic surfaces (like glass or metal oxides) and organic polymer matrices, creating a robust interfacial linkage. This makes it particularly valuable when working with challenging substrates or when aiming for superior performance under demanding conditions.

The application of Bis(diethylamino)dimethylsilane extends beyond traditional coupling roles. Its properties also make it beneficial in areas like semiconductor manufacturing and specialty polymer synthesis. For instance, its ability to facilitate the deposition of silicon-based thin films is critical for the reliability of electronic devices. Furthermore, it acts as a precursor in creating silicone polymers with enhanced flexibility and thermal stability, sought after in the automotive and aerospace sectors.
